Hitman: Blood Money – Reprisal Launches January 25th for Nintendo Switch

The updated title is available to pre-order on the Nintendo eShop and features Instinct Mode, a new mini-map and alerts.

Feral Interactive’s Hitman: Blood Money – Reprisal is coming to Nintendo Switch on January 25th. Available for iOS and Android, it’s a digital-only purchase on the Nintendo eShop for $29.99 (though pre-orders can get it for $24.99).

As an updated version of IO Interactive’s classic stealth action title, Hitman: Blood Money – Reprisal adds Instinct Mode, which indicates points of interest, targets and guards. It’s a great way to seek opportunities and plan kills, utilizing the sandbox to your advantage, and the new mini-map helps to keep track of one’s surroundings. New alerts also help keep players on their toes when rousing suspicion.

It remains to be seen if Reprisal will support the Switch version’s touchscreen like on mobiles or the Joy-Cons. Stay tuned for more details when it goes live.
